What is involved in tuck pointing my masonry?

Tuck pointing involves removing old, deteriorated mortar from between bricks or stones and replacing it with new mortar. This process strengthens the masonry and prevents water infiltration. They'll then carefully remove the damaged sections before applying the new mortar. It's a detailed job that requires precision for a lasting result.

What are the steps for a concrete patio installation?

Installing a concrete patio involves several key steps. First, the area is excavated and a proper base of gravel and sand is compacted. Forms are set to define the patio's shape and dimensions. The concrete is then mixed and poured into the forms, leveled, and finished to your desired texture. After curing, expansion joints are cut to prevent cracking. This ensures a durable and long-lasting patio for your home in Kansas City.

How often should I pressure wash my driveway?

You should pressure wash your driveway in Kansas City typically once or twice a year, depending on its condition and surrounding environment. This helps remove dirt, oil stains, mold, and mildew that can accumulate over time. Regular cleaning maintains the driveway's appearance and can prevent permanent staining. It's a good idea to do it in the spring or fall. Ensure the pressure is set correctly to avoid damaging the surface.
